Transaction 1e61aa183ca500a2a5a8346c9f9eb6b275ba9f18c622717377ccaeff14714144
1 Input
1 Output
-
1e61aa183ca500a2a5a8346c9f9eb6b275ba9f18c622717377ccaeff14714144:0
- value
- 622404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b5bbe95e32a13acc9cc0aeb56779ea158cbe30c OP_EQUAL
- address
- 32j5GAuyVWcNX15bvFmbKG2N6u3KaQ63wG